The clamps I have now were designed to fit the S2R generation of bikes with 22mm bars.
The correct conversion is...
22mm / 25.4 = .866"
I don't know what I was thinking on that earlier post ... massive brain cramp I suppose.
Therefore, the clamps I have now will not fit 1 1/8" bars.
You would need to measure to find out ... remove one of your existing clamps and measure the distance across the radius inside the clamp. You could do this with a tape measure and the measurement would be close enough since it will either be close to .866" or 1.125"
